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
---|---|
10th Percentile Wage | $28,010 |
25th Percentile Wage | $31,600 |
50th Percentile Wage | $37,720 |
75th Percentile Wage | $46,740 |
90th Percentile Wage | $53,330 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salaries for electromechanical equipment assemblers in the industry of machine shops. The salaries are shown in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) electromechanical equipment assemblers is $53,330. The median annual salary (50th percentile) is $37,720.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ent electromechanical equipment assemblers is $28,010.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of electromechanical equipment assemblers in the industry of Machine Shops from 2012 to 2016.
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 4-Year Growth |
---|---|---|---|
2016 | $37,720 | 10.71% | 13.28% |
2015 | $33,680 | 3.00% | - |
2014 | $32,670 | 9.58% | - |
2013 | $29,540 | -10.73% | - |
2012 | $32,710 | - | - |
